About the Book
Tales from below the waist takes us on a journey of discovery,from the post-World War II sensibilities of working class Northern England to late twentieth century romanticism of Catalan Spain.On the way, we share young Jack York's pleasures of the flesh taken in women,ale and sport as he pursues personal fulfillment.This extraordinary tale unfolds across the decades,as a wiser Jack sheds his doubts and grasps true love,ably abetted by the reformed rascal Jingo and other inimitable characters. About the Author
J. J. RYDER is a Yorkshire man from Hull who spent his formative years moving around the North of England, eventually becoming a specialist as the NSPCC inspector for North Yorkshire investigating the causes and treatment of child abuse with that national child protective agency. He also spent many years in senior manager with a national cancer charity, later choosing to attend university as a mature student. His love of sport has always played an important part in his life. Various professional roles encompassed dealing with the media being the subject of newspaper articles, often appearing on radio and TV. He uses his childhood and youthful memories in writing “tales” bringing to life the characters described. Most of the events mentioned are true, and today he lives in East Yorkshire preparing future novels.
